WebNational Center for Biotechnology Information WebThe average salary for an embalmer in this country is $45,060 a year, according the United States Bureau of Labor Statistics. This amount can vary greatly, however, depending upon location, education, experience, and job title. This means that new graduates may earn as little as $27,000, but those with experience may earn as much as $64,400 a ...

WebIn most cases, morticians must be at least 21 years old, hold an associate degree from a mortuary science program accredited by the American Board of Funeral Science Education, complete an apprenticeship, and pass a certification exam. WebFuneral Director. 1: a person whose job is to arrange and manage funerals. Mortician. 1: a person whose job is to prepare dead people to be buried and to arrange and manage funerals.
